**Core Concept**
Hardness of dental materials, particularly elastomers, is a critical property that determines their resistance to deformation and wear. The Shore A durometer is the most commonly used method to measure the hardness of elastomers, which correlates with their relative hardness.
**Why the Correct Answer is Right**
The Shore A durometer measures the hardness of elastomers by determining the depth of penetration of a needle into the material under a given load. The Shore A scale ranges from 0 to 100, with higher values indicating greater hardness. The relative hardness of elastomers is directly related to their molecular structure, cross-link density, and polymerization degree. The Shore A durometer is a reliable and widely accepted method for evaluating the hardness of elastomers, making it a crucial tool for dental material selection and evaluation.
